Output f8e757472731c5fab2c4ee25b8dbe3edb858dcc4560c42dbf162fcb8221f9ce7:54

value
25455263
script pubkey
OP_0 OP_PUSHBYTES_20 bd26a9a7c57cd13df716a36311f265502c75891a
address
ltc1qh5n2nf790ngnmack5d33run92qk8tzg6cm9r3u
transaction
f8e757472731c5fab2c4ee25b8dbe3edb858dcc4560c42dbf162fcb8221f9ce7
spent
true